Without question, the American medical craft\u2014defined as the physicians, clinicians and healthcare organisations that comprise the American healthcare sector\u2014provides immense value to patients and contributes expertise on matters relevant to the public\u2019s health. As caregivers, clinicians navigate uncertainty over diagnosis and prognosis, make difficult therapeutic choices, and save lives through their treatment decisions. However, several conspicuous realities about the cost and quality of healthcare in America should give the reader pause, particularly when assessing claims about the American medical craft\u2019s wisdom and prudence in matters related to the public\u2019s health.<\/p>\n<p>To examine who should have what authority over matters of public health, this paper invokes the teachings of Plato\u2019s Socrates and explores the claim that the United States has been hampered by less-than-ideal public health decision making. This paper further explores the notion that public health decision making has been adversely impacted by the overextended reach of medical craft expertise, as permitted by the American democratic political system.<\/p>\n<p>A key takeaway? There is no time like the present for reflection\u2014 honest reflection beyond what the vogue policy models or power elites posit. \u00a0American thought-leaders and policymakers must not forget that the debate over craft skill, deep knowledge, sophistry and who should have what decision-making influence in public affairs is not new. Rather, it is an ancient debate, and now as then, the ancient arguments remain relevant in the democratic context. To Plato\u2019s Socrates, the public\u2019s health, including the equitable appropriation, allocation and distribution of health-related resources, should be the responsibility of the state and its statesmen.
